Replacing the Top Cover

Dell Studio XPS™ 435T/9000 Service Manual


WARNING: Before working inside your computer, read the safety information that shipped with your computer. For additional safety best practices information, see the Regulatory Compliance Homepage at ww.dell.com/regulatory_compliance.
  1. Follow the procedures in Before You Begin.

  2. Remove the computer cover (see Replacing the Computer Cover).

  3. Remove the front panel (see Replacing the Front Panel).

  4. Remove the two screws that secure the top cover to the computer.

  5. Disconnect the cables from the top I/O panel.

  6. Pull the release tab with one hand and slide the top cover away from the chassis.

  7. Disconnect the power LED cable from the top cover.

  1. Remove the I/O panel (see Replacing the I/O Panel).

  2. Set the computer top cover aside in a secure location.

  3. To replace the top cover, perform the removal procedure in reverse order.
